Symbiosis SET Eligibility Criteria 2027: Qualification and Marks
Under the Symbiosis SET eligibility criteria 2027, you must complete Class 12 (10+2) or an equivalent examination from a recognised board to apply. The minimum required marks are 50% for the General category and 45% for SC/ST candidates. Candidates appearing for their Class 12 exams can apply provisionally, but admission is confirmed only after meeting the required marks during final result verification. If you have completed your education from a foreign board, you must submit an equivalence certificate from the Association of Indian Universities (AIU) to validate your qualification.

Symbiosis SET 2027 Programme-wise Eligibility Criteria for Participating Institutes
The eligibility criteria for SET 2027 vary slightly across institutes and programmes such as BBA, BBA (IT), and specialised courses. While most programmes require a minimum of 50% marks in Class 12 (45% for reserved categories), some courses also specify additional requirements, including minimum CGPA or English language proficiency scores for eligible candidates. The table below provides a programme-wise overview of the SET 2027 eligibility criteria across participating Symbiosis institutes.
| Participating Institutes For SET 2027 | List of Programmes | Eligibility Criteria |
|---|---|---|
| – SCMS Pune – SCMS Noida – SCMS Nagpur – SCMS Bengaluru – SCMS Hyderabad | – B.B.A. (Honours / Honours with Research) |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Honours with Research: Minimum 7.5 CGPA at the end of Semester-6.Lateral/Multiple entry as per University rules. |
| – SCMS Pune – SCMS Noida – SCMS Bengaluru | – B.B.A. (Honours / Honours with Research Global Dual Degree (Deakin University, Australia) |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Additional conditions for transition to Deakin University:• Complete first two years with WAM 55 (CGPA 6.25)• IELTS minimum score of 6. |
| – SICSR | – B.B.A. (Information Technology) Honours / Honours with Research |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Honours with Research: Minimum 7.5 CGPA at the end of Semester-6. |
| – SCMC | – B.B.A. (Media Management) Honours / Honours with Research |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Honours with Research: Minimum 7.5 CGPA at the end of Semester-6. |
| SAII Pune | – B.B.A. (Artificial Intelligence) Honours / Honours with Research |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Honours with Research: Minimum 7.5 CGPA at the end of Semester-6. |
| SSCANS Pune | – B.B.A. (Hospitality and Culinary Management) Honours / Honours with Research | – Passed Standard XII (10+2) or equivalent from any recognised Board with minimum 50% marks (45% for SC/ST). – Honours with Research: Minimum 7.5 CGPA at the end of Semester-6. |

Symbiosis SET Reservation Policy 2027
The Symbiosis SET Reservation Policy 2027 allocates seats to eligible reserved categories after candidates satisfy the SET 2027 eligibility criteria and complete the admission process. Reservation is provided either within the sanctioned intake or over and above the approved intake, depending on the category and the participating institute.
If you are eligible under more than one reserved category, you must select only one reservation category while filling out the SET application form. The selected category cannot be changed after the application is submitted, and candidates must produce the prescribed supporting documents during the admission process.
| Category for Reservation Policy 2027 | Seat Percentage / Allocation | Mandatory Documents Required |
|---|---|---|
| Scheduled Caste (SC) | 15% within intake | SC Caste Certificate issued by the competent authority |
| Scheduled Tribe (ST) | 7.5% within intake | ST Caste Certificate issued by the competent authority |
| Persons with Disabilities (PwD) | 3% within intake | PwD Medical Certificate issued by a recognised Medical Board |
| Wards of Defence Personnel | 5% within intake (applicable at select institutes such as SICSR) | Official Defence Service Certificate / Authenticated Proof |
| Nagpur Domicile Category | 25% (applicable only to SCMS Nagpur) | Local Domicile Certificate (minimum five years of residency) |
| Kashmiri Migrants / Kashmiri Pandits | 2 seats per programme (over and above intake) | Migration Certificate issued by the competent state authority |

Symbiosis SET Eligibility Criteria for International Students
Symbiosis SET eligibility for international students is defined through academic qualification and certification requirements. Candidates must complete Class 12 or equivalent from a recognised foreign board and submit 1 mandatory equivalence certificate issued by the Association of Indian Universities. As per the SET Eligibility Criteria, international applicants fall under categories such as Foreign Nationals, NRI, OCI, and PIO, with additional documentation required during admission.
